2003 (Posts 4937 through 21862)
2003 was a new age in Ubersite, and though it was Uber's first "modern" year, there were some differences from today. There were still automated submissions, though they played a much smaller role and would be soon fazed out. There was a 1 megabyte limit on attachments, and bitmaps were very rare.
Multiple +2s or -2s from the same user could affect the post's average rating, and -2 spamming was not punishable by bannings (yet). Nobody had been banned at all so far, although a certain user called Drink_DDT would soon rectify that.
There was no account verification, and anyone could sign up instantly. On that matter, there was no need to sign up at all, anyone could make anonymous comments under the default name of Random Joe.

2003 was truly Uber's climactic rise into prominence. In previous years the number of users had been under four hundred, and few posts as well. By the end of 2003, there were 4500 users and over twenty thousand posts, each of them lovingly crafted by their creator.
Many authors such as Fat Tony, Habeeb, Loki and Squattail had established themselves and carved out a place for themselves on the Uber totem pole. Much of the present MVA had arrived, and Method was preparing to unleash such a reign of terror from his alters, the very foundations of Uber would tremble.
In light of the multiple trolls and variables in the population of Uber, Bart saw the need to wield more power. You could now get banned, and -2 spamming was frowned upon. Alters were coming into their own, and the Uber of 2003 would be very recognizable to the Uber of 2006.

Users registered on Ubersite
1999: 1 - ? (Users 2-10 not logged)
2000: 11 - 19
2001: 20 - 50 (51, 52, 53 not logged)
2002: 54 - 393 (394 - 406 not logged)
2003: 407 - 4605
2004: 4606 - 15120
2005: 15121 - 24393
2006: 24394 - 25575 (As of the end of march 1st)
Averages per day registration:
1999: Around .002
2000: Between .002 and .004
2001: Between .008 and .009
2002: Between .928 and .969
2003: 11.501
2004: 28.726
2005: 25.402
2006: 19.683 (Up to March 1st)
Of Ubersite's current population (25592) :
.03% registered in 1999.
.03% registered in 2000.
.1% registered in 2001.
1% registered in 2002.
16% registered in 2003.
41% registred in 2004.
36% registered in 2005.
4% registed in 2006.
Ubersite peaked in 2004 without question.

These posts are starting to freak me out. They are like reading about Ubersite in a slightly different universe, where most of what you talked about happened, some of it happened kind of differently, and other important things that happened didn't get mentioned.
This must be what it feels like to see a made for TV movie about yourself.
Some things I thought I'd point out or mention:
I think Loren1 is an important person to mention, because she was one of the integral members of the first little "uber-clique" that formed... while in retrospect I can acknowledge that it was a clique, it was also something more important:
The idea had really begun to gel that Ubersite was more than just a place where you would just go and read random shit by random people. It began to be a place where you would see the same people again and again, and before long you were talking with them more than once in a day, email addresses and IM names began to be exchanged, and a very "Cheers-like" feeling developed.
DDT was the first person who really challenged that although he became one of us in the end.
bart has never revealed this to anyone so far as I know, but I am willing to throw it out there now.
I'm a large part of the reason DDT got banned. I wrote bart a really long email about how this guy was fucking up Ubersite and how the community of people that had begun to form around Ubersite was getting ticked and would leave if he was just allowed to be... MEAN... to everyone without any reprecussions. I basically told bart his MVA list was going to leave if the guy kept it up... I'm not proud of this at all in retrospect but I swear it made sense at the time...
It was only a day or so after I wrote it that that pic went up and bart banned him.
Here's a post I wrote two years ago declaring the "Modern Uberversary" to be February 12th, 2003. I think it's pretty relevant as a snapshot of the time... my thoughts about Uber have changed in a lot of ways since then
http://www.ubersite.com/m/25430
It's funny, I mention the first Ubercon in there, even though there was no phrase "Ubercon" at the time.
There was also a rather embarrassing incident where somebody wrote something anti-semitic, and I set up a script to give him a -2 and loop one thousand times... I didn't get banned for it, but I did get in quite a bit of trouble and I made a public apology.
http://www.ubersite.com/m/10153
What's funny is that the reason I did it is because back then one thousand -2s from the same user counted as - 2000, not -2, so I thoguht it was guarantee that he would never have a better rating than -1.99
I also think towards the end of this year that bart changed the formula on how ratings were calculated so that the author of a post couldn't affect the rating... which made a lot of people feel better about their own post.
